Pain, tenderness, swelling and pressure around your eyes, cheeks, nose or forehead that … WebA nosebleed is bleeding from tissues inside the nose (nasal mucus membranes) caused by a broken blood vessel. The medical word for nosebleed is epistaxis. Most nosebleeds in children occur in the front part of the nose close to the nostrils. This part of the nose has many tiny blood vessels. These can be damaged easily. A Chinese woman has become the first person to ever die from the H3N8 strain of bird flu raising fears of another pandemic. The 56-year-old, from the Guangdong province, first became ill on February 22 but was admitted to the hospital with severe pneumonia on March 3.
